Output 76e32a305fcbd574dcaf57855186f61b16096997d359c0e9c8a843baaf84fb01:0

value
422980
script pubkey
OP_0 OP_PUSHBYTES_20 dbc51be04199338e8509e89e27bfd5cff6fa0db7
address
bc1qm0z3hczpnyecapgfaz0z0074elm05rdhx065zn
transaction
76e32a305fcbd574dcaf57855186f61b16096997d359c0e9c8a843baaf84fb01
spent
true